Transaction 163c0e2ec87dac1dd96880f738a9a017497df3f7bdedffab4246c275929cea50

block
18dd8454dd592fe3ffef0cabe96a2928f93f620ad27affed8ae5046e6a075494

1 Input

24 Outputs